How to Play Drunk Driver: You need a friend, a deck of cards and a beer . One plays the driver the other is the dealer . The dealer places six cards face down . The driver turns each card over in turn . If the value of the flipped is between 2 and 10 the driver doesn't take a drink . If the dealer flips a jack the driver must take a sip or a shot . A new card is dealt after one is turned . Flip a queen and the driver must sink two sips or shots and add two cards to the row . Flip a king and the driver must take three shots or sips and add three cards to the row . Flip an ace and the driver must take four sips or shots and add four cards to the row . The game ends when all cards are used - the dealer then becomes the driver.
